The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Thomas Nowles, born in 1831 in Gloucester, Gloucestershire, consisted of 2 members. Thomas was the head of the household, widower.
During the period, also present in the household was Thomas's Nephew, James Lane, born in 1856 in Birmingham, Warwickshire, England.
